abstract = {Virtual fashion design, using 3D modeling and artificial intelligence (AI), is a big change in the fashion industry. This new method allows designers to create, visualize, and test clothing in a digital environment. This means they require fewer real-world samples and waste less material. Designers can create realistic virtual clothes using programs such as CLO 3D, Browzwear, and Marvelous Designer.AI boosts creativity, automates design tasks, and forecasts fashion trends, while providing personalized styling advice. Customers can use AI-powered virtual try-on technology to see how clothes look on digital models or in their own photos, which enhances online shopping and lowers returns. Integrating these technologies promotes sustainable practices by increasing production efficiency and lowering environmental impact. The combination of 3D modeling and AI is transforming design and production, opening up new possibilities in digital fashion markets such as gaming, virtual reality, and the met averse. As the fashion industry shifts toward digital strategies, AI-powered virtual fashion design is critical for innovation, sustainability, and personalized experiences, ushering in a new era of fashion technology.},
